Jean-Marie de Wurstemberger


Jean-Marie (“Jan”) de Wurstemberger began studying Buddhism in the Tibetan tradition in the mid-1990s. His principal teacher at the time advised him, above all, to “just sit” – guidance that seemed rather unusual in the Tibetan context and that reminded more of a Zen master’s instruction. Soon afterwards, an unexpected encounter with the Theravada monk and experienced meditation teacher Bhante Sujiva gave this advice a clear and incisive form: Vipassana. Jan has now practised insight meditation under Bhante Sujiva’s guidance for more than 25 years. In German-speaking countries, he also serves as Bhante Sujiva’s interpreter during retreats and co-translated his standard work on insight meditation, Tree of Wisdom, River of No Return, into German. In his professional life, Jan works in Switzerland as a teacher, counsellor, and systemic coach, supporting teenagers, their families, and young adults living independently.
